Engine Operation with
Intermittent Diagnostic Codes
If a diagnostic lamp illuminates during normal engine
operation and the diagnostic lamp shuts off, an
intermittent fault may have occurred. If a fault has
occurred, the fault will be logged into the memory of
the Electronic Control Module (ECM).
In most cases, an intermittent code will not require
the engine to be stopped. The operator should
retrieve the logged fault codes and reference the
appropriate information in order to identify the nature
of the event. The operator should log any observation
that could have caused the lamp to light.
• Low power
• Limits of the engine speed
• Excessive smoke
This information can be useful to help troubleshoot
the situation. The information can also be used for
future reference. For more information on diagnostic
codes, refer to the Troubleshooting Guide for this
engine.
